Product Development Coordinator

Company: Michael Page
Location: Torrance
Posted on: April 28, 2024

Job Description:

My client is looking for a Product Development Coordinator or and Associate Product Development Manager. This person will be crucial in helping the company with marketing strategy and product innovation. Client DetailsMy client is a chemical company focused on cleaning products.Description

  • Conduct research to comprehend and analyze the competitive landscape within designated categories.
  • Foster connections with all cross-functional teams.
  • Establish rapport with relevant suppliers.
  • Gain a comprehensive understanding of the product development lifecycle for each assigned category.
  • Take the lead in managing the product development process for New Product Introductions (NPI) within the designated categories.
  • Evaluate and outline financials for all Stock Keeping Units (SKUs) in the assigned categories.
  • Publish schedules for all NPI launches within the designated categories.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(Media, Finance, Operations, Planning, Quality, Sales) to ensure adherence to NPI timelines.
  • Oversee pricing strategies for NPI and existing SKUs in the designated categories, continually monitoring profitability to meet gross margin objectives.
  • Coordinate NPI launches with suppliers, negotiating pricing, tooling, and timelines.
  • Assume ownership of designated product portfolios, becoming the primary subject matter expert across all SKUs within the assigned categories.
  • Provide regular updates to senior management on NPI progress throughout each development phase on a monthly basis.
  • Participate in monthly Sales and Operations Planning (S&OP) meetings to ensure alignment with category budgets.
  • Monitor and evaluate SKU performance based on Point of Sale (POS) data, profitability, and customer feedback.
  • Collaborate with Operations on initiatives for dual-sourcing to drive cost reductions and address supply chain gaps.
  • Work with Quality to enhance product performance as issues arise.
  • Partner with Planning & Finance to assess SKU performance and potentially rationalize SKUs as necessary.
  • Identify and engage with new strategic suppliers.
  • Explore and generate innovative concepts and ideas based on market trends, competitive analysis, and emerging technologies.Profile
